Ir para conteúdo
Fórum Script Brasil

Thiago Torres

Membros
  • Total de itens

    5
  • Registro em

  • Última visita

Posts postados por Thiago Torres

  1. Boa Tarde Galera,

    Estou fazendo um script ASP que faz um SELECT em uma pagina denominada de GERA_SQL.ASP

    esta página cria uma SESSÃO SQL que retorna por exemplo:

    SELECT COUNT(*) AS TOTAL FROM USUARIOS WHERE GRUPO = 5 ORDER BY NOME ASC

    e redireciono a GERA_SQL para uma denominada de ENVIO.ASP que resgata a SESSÃO "SQL"

    e é ai que está meu problema.

    Estou fazendo a seguinte linha:

    sql = Session("SQL")& "LIMIT " & (PaginaAtual - 1) * pageSize & " , " & pageSize & ""

    set objRS = objConn.execute(sql)

    Mas o MySQL retorna o seguinte erro:

    [MySQL][ODBC 3.51 Driver][mysqld-5.0.22-log]You have an error in your SQL syntax;

    check the manual that corresponds to your MySQL server version for the right syntax to use near '0 , 2' at line 1

    Já fiz um tanto de modificações, mas ainda não domino muito as sintaxes do MySQL, se puderem me auxiliar, por favor..

  2. Galera, estou com dificuldade em resolver um problema no código abaixo:

    É o código que monto o conteúdo do e-mail a ser enviado pelo CDONTS

    No detalhe em vermelho é onde ocorre o erro, não sei como fazer a concatenação !!!

    <%

    MensagemUser = "<html><head></head><body>" _

    & "<p><font face='Verdana, Arial, Helvetica, sans-serif' Size='4'><b>Novo contato através do Site:</b></font></p>" _

    & "<p><font face='Verdana, Arial, Helvetica, sans-serif' size='2'>" _

    & "<br><p>" _

    & "Nome:<b>" & request("_nome") & "</b><br>" _

    if dpto = "fornecedores" then

    '& "Cidade:<b>" & request("_cidade_flats") & "</b><br>" _

    end if

    & "Atenciosamente,<br>" _

    & "</font></p>" _

    & "<p><font face='Verdana, Arial, Helvetica, sans-serif' size='2'><b>Thiago Torres- www.thiagotorres.com.br</b><br>" _

    & "</body></html>"

    response.write "Enviado com Sucesso!!!!"

    %>

  3. Olá galera,

    bom já não entendo mais...rsrsrs

    é o seguinte, eu tenho duas tabelas: import e destinatarios

    na import eu tenho nome e email e na destinatarios também

    eu to tentando rodar o código abaixo para que ele exclua da tabela DESTINATARIOS

    os emails que estão na tabela IMPORT.

    Mais aí está o problema...por exemplo:

    na tabela DESTINATARIOS eu tenho 10 registros e cadastrei na tabela IMPORT 2 registros que existem

    na tabela DESTINATARIOS, porém quando eu rodo o script ele não exclui, mas se eu tenho os mesmos

    10 registros na IMPORT ele exclui tudo normal...o que será que está faltando que ele só exclui se

    os registros forem os mesmos nas duas tabelas ???? me ajudem aeeeeeee

    ##########################################

    <%

    Set objConn= Server.CreateObject("ADODB.Connection")

    objConn.Open =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source="&ConexaoNewsletter&";"

    Set objRS = Server.CreateObject("ADODB.RecordSet")

    stringSQL = "select * from import order by nome"

    objRS.open stringSQL,objConn,3,3

    %>

    <%

    while not objRS.eof

    objConn.Execute("DELETE FROM destinatarios WHERE nome = '" & objRS("nome") & "' and email ='" & objRS("email") & "';")

    objRS.MoveNext

    Wend

    objConn.Execute("DELETE * FROM import")

    response.redirect "grupos.asp"

    %>

    <%

    objRS.close

    objConn.close

    Set objConn = Nothing

    %>

    ##########################################################

  4. Galera, to com uma dúvida...existe alguma função

    ou algum macete usado para alinhar algo no c++ ???

    Estou fazendo um PRINTF, no qual na primeira linha uso como uma linha fixa e debaixo dela coloco um FOR para listar

    os registro encontrados...Pois bem, sem nenhum problema para

    fazer isto...o que acontece é o seguinte, eu queria que ficasse alinhado os registros como abaixo:

    ---------------------------------------------------------

    | Código | Descricao | Valor | Qtd. |

    ---------------------------------------------------------

    | 12345 | Caneta Azul | 1.25 | 150 |

    ---------------------------------------------------------

    | 12346 | Caneta Vermelha | 1.30 | 290 |

    ---------------------------------------------------------

    E por aí vai...mais acontece que quando eu digito por exemplo um código com menos digitos, ou mais...a barra

    que separa cada coluna, se move, como abaixo:

    ---------------------------------------------------------

    | Código | Descricao | Valor | Qtd. |

    ---------------------------------------------------------

    | 12345 | Caneta Azul | 1.25 | 150 |

    ---------------------------------------------------------

    | 123 | Caneta Vermelha | 1.30 | 290 |

    ---------------------------------------------------------

    Gostaria de saber se conhecem alguma maneira de deixar

    ela fixa, independente do numero de digitos que no caso

    o campo CODIGO vai possuir....

    ABAIXO A IMAGEM EXPLICANDO O QUE QUERO:

    devc++.gif

    Obrigado galera

×
×
  • Criar Novo...